American Airways has canceled greater than 1,000 flights since Friday, disruptions it blamed on staffing issues and excessive winds at its busiest hub.
On Saturday, American canceled practically 460 flights, or 17% of its mainline schedule, in line with flight-tracking web site FlightAware. Dallas-based Southwest Airways reduce 86 flights, or 2% of its Saturday operation.
American canceled one other 285 flights, or 10% of its schedule deliberate for Sunday, on high of 340 cancellations on Friday.
American’s COO David Seymour stated in a employees observe on Saturday that the issues began with excessive wind gusts on Thursday that reduce capability at its Dallas/Fort Price Worldwide Airport hub and that crew members ended up out of place for his or her subsequent flights.
Pilot and flight attendant availability have been listed as causes for a lot of the cancellations on Saturday and Sunday, in line with inside tallies, which have been seen by CNBC.
“With extra climate all through the system, our staffing begins to run tight as crew members find yourself out of their common flight sequences,” Seymour wrote. He stated that almost all prospects have been rebooked the identical day and that he expects the operation to stabilize in November.
Airways have struggled with staffing shortfalls which have sparked lots of of flight cancellations and different disruptions since journey demand rebounded sharply in late spring. Carriers had satisfied hundreds of employees members to simply accept voluntary buyouts or leaves of absence to chop their payroll bills through the depths of the pandemic.
Now they’re making an attempt to employees up once more, hiring pilots, flight attendants, ramp and customer support employees, and others. Leaner staffing makes it more durable for airways to recuperate from disruptions like unhealthy climate or know-how issues.
Southwest earlier this month stated {that a} meltdown earlier this month during which it canceled greater than 2,000 flights value it $75 million. It additionally stated it could additional trim its remaining 2021 schedule after earlier cuts to keep away from extra disruptions.
American Airways’ Seymour stated that 1,800 flight attendants could be coming back from depart beginning Nov. 1 and that the remaining could be again by December. It stated it is also within the means of hiring pilots, mechanics, airport employees and reservations brokers “so extra staff members will likely be in place for the vacation season.”
